Inside The 10 Most Expensive Private Jets In The World 2022



1. Air Force One , $660 Million, The most expensive private jet in the world is Air Force One. It’s a 4,000squarefoot, tripledecker monster owned and maintained by the US government that can carry 100 passengers and 26 crew members. The jet can reach a top speed of 650 mph and is loaded with cuttingedge technology. It is equipped with its own hospital and operating facility and is designed to withstand meteor assaults, earthquakes, and nuclear war. It also has the ability to refuel in midflight and is always given first priority over other aircraft!

2. Boeing 747 refit, $ 617 Million. The second jet on the list of the top 10 most expensive private jets in the world is Boeing 747 refit. It belongs to an unnamed billionaire, and there isn’t much information about how it’s outfitted on the inside. What we do know is that it has been extensively updated and remodeled on the interior, with the finest luxury furniture available anywhere in the world. It boasts its own onboard restaurant, as well as various bedrooms, toilets, and lounges. If you need a snooze, one of the eight private double bedrooms on the upper deck is waiting for you!

3. Airbus A380 Custom cost $500 Million, Another jet on the list of the top 10 most expensive private jets in the world Airbus A380 Custom. It is owned by a Saudi Arabia business mogul, Prince AlWaleed bin Tala, The jumbo jet is claimed to include its own symphony hall, Turkish baths, prayer rooms, and a garage big enough to fit a couple of RollsRoyces! The gigantic airliner is said to include its own symphony theater, Turkish baths, prayer rooms, and a garage big enough to fit two RollsRoyces! And also,, the reason it costs so much is that a standard commercial A380 costs $400 million; but, when the prince opted to decorate the interior, the price quickly climbed to $500 million.

4. Boeing 7478 Intercontinental BBJ cost $403 Million, The 7478 Intercontinental BBJ, like its younger brother, the 787 BBJ, will set you back $403 million before you’ve even picked up a paintbrush. The Hong Kong business mogulowned private jet is the fourth on the list of the top 10 most expensive private jets in the world. This beast has nearly 4,800 square feet of interior space, including a fully equipped office, bedrooms, toilets, and a dining room that converts to a corporate boardroom.

5. Airbus A340300 cost $350 Million, Alisher Usmanov, Russia’s richest billionaire, owns the world’s fifth most expensive private jet in the world. Despite the fact that he paid $238 Million for the plane, he went to great lengths to make it his own. Unfortunately, the plane’s specifics are kept under wraps, but it is said to have a nightclub in addition to what must be a sumptuous interior.

6. Boeing 747430 cost $233 Million, The sixth private jet on the list of the top 10 most expensive private jets in the world is the Boeing 747 which is owned by the Sultan of Brunei. Also known as The Dreamliner and the model in question has a total usable area of roughly 5000 square feet. Despite its high price, this Boeing airplane has a fairly simple design, and its master bedroom rivals many fivestar hotels.

7. Boeing 7878 BBJ cost $224 Million, The Boeing 7878 BBJ is one of the top 10 most expensive private jets in the world, costing a whopping $224 million. The BBJ stands for “Boeing Business Jet,” and the plane has about 2,400 square feet of space. It can also sleep up to 39 people and features a magnificent master bedroom. There’s a walkin closet, a double bathroom, and heated marble floors in the suite!

8. Boeing 76733A (ER) cost $170 Million, After a deal with Hawaiian Airlines fell through, Abramovich purchased the plane from Boeing and had it refitted to his specifications. His collection of pricey luxury toys wouldn’t be complete without one of the world’s most expensive private jets, so he went all out. Because of its cockpit paint job, the Boeing 76733A (ER) interior has been decked in gold and furnished with solid chestnut furniture, earning it the moniker “The Bandit.”

9. Boeing 74781 VIP cost $153 Million, This Boeing 747 is no ordinary 747, hence the VIP in its name and price tag! It is owned by Hong Kong real estate tycoon Joesph Lau, and features all the latest technology and gadgets, ensuring Mr. Lau’s journeys are as comfortable as possible.

10. Gulfstream III cost $125 Million, The Gulfstream III is currently owned by Tyler Perry, an American producer, actor, and filmmaker. The jet has undergone extensive customization throughout the years and can accommodate up to 14 people.
